Use Lipstick as Blush

This age old trick comes in handy when you do not have a blush but want to give your cheeks a nice flush. Simply dab some lipstick onto your cheeks and blend it in well with your fingers. The key here is to blend it well to make sure there are no streaks. Once that’s done, top it off with some compact powder for a neat finish.

Use Credit Card or Tape as a Guide

If you are like me and find it difficult to get neat clean, precise lines with your eye liner, then this nifty trick will help you out. Simply use a credit card or cellophane tape as a guide. You can stick the tape onto your skin in the desired angle and length and then use the eye liner. Alternatively, you can also use a credit card to ensure your lines are precise.

Turn Your Kohl into a Gel Liner

All you need is a lighter to turn your kohl pencil into a gel eye liner. Hold your kohl in the flame of the lighter for five seconds and then allow it to cool completely (30 to 40 seconds). Now swipe it on over your lids and you will be amazed at the gel liner like consistency of the pencil. This trick also intensifies the colour so that your black kohl will transform into an even-more-intense-black liner.

Use Mascara as Eye Liner and Vice Versa

There are instances when you dip into your liquid eye liner only to realize that it’s dried up. In such instances, simply use the eye liner brush and dab it on the mascara wand to pick up the colour and then use it as an eye liner. This can work the other way as well. So if your mascara has dried out, dab eye liner onto your mascara wand and use it on your lashes.

Use a Spoon or a Business Card to Avoid Mascara Mishaps

Don’t you just hate it when you accidentally get mascara all over your eye lids? Not only is it difficult to get it off but more often than not, you will have to re-apply your eye makeup from scratch and that can be a very time consuming process. So to avoid that scenario, use a spoon or a business card as a protective layer between your eye lids and the mascara wand.

Get Fuller Looking Lips in an Instant

Dab on a lighter shade of lipstick or even a light eye shadow onto the centre of your top and bottom lips for fuller looking lips.

Mix Eye Shadow with Lip Balm for Lipstick

If you do not have a lipstick with you, simply mix a pink or coral eyeshadow with a little lip balm and apply this onto your lips for some colour.
